Add 63/8 and 12/70
1st number: 7 7/8, 2nd number: 12/70
63/8 + 12/70 is 2253/280.
Steps for adding f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 8 and 70 is 280
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 280 - For the 1st fraction, since 8 × 35 = 280,
63/8 = 63 × 35/8 × 35 = 2205/280 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 70 × 4 = 280,
12/70 = 12 × 4/70 × 4 = 48/280 - Add the two like fractions:
2205/280 + 48/280 = 2205 + 48/280 = 2253/280 - So, 63/8 + 12/70 = 2253/280
In mixed form: 813/280
